The Rise of Gamification in Environmental Education
Research from the Gamification Research Network indicates that incorporating game mechanics into environmental programs can increase participant motivation by up to 30%, leading to higher rates of sustainable behavior adoption (Johnson & Lee, 2022). These mechanics include point systems, leaderboards, rewards, and challenges, which tap into intrinsic motivations such as mastery, autonomy, and social connection.
Complex issues like climate change require repeated learning and consistent action, which traditional educational methods often struggle to instill. Gamified solutions leverage psychological drivers that reinforce habits through immediate feedback and a sense of achievement, making sustainable behaviors more rewarding and resilient over time.
The Power of Interactive Gaming: Bridging Knowledge and Action
| Aspect | Traditional Education | Gamified Approaches |
|---|---|---|
| Engagement | Variable; often passive | Active, immersive experiences |
| Behavior Reinforcement | Limited immediate feedback | Instant feedback, rewards, and progress tracking |
| Learning Retention | Moderate; depends on repetition | Enhanced; interactive reinforcement boosts memory |
| Community Building | Rarely emphasizes social aspects | Leverages social competition and cooperation |
One of the most promising applications of gamification in this context is the development of digital environmental games that simulate real-world ecological systems. Such virtual environments allow players to experiment with sustainable practices in a risk-free setting, reinforcing real-world decision-making skills.

Future Directions and Challenges
While gamification holds immense potential, it also faces hurdles such as ensuring inclusivity, preventing superficial engagement, and maintaining long-term motivation. As the industry matures, more rigorous evaluation and tailored content will be crucial. Furthermore, integrating data-driven insights can optimize these tools for diverse demographics, increasing their impact.
